Shell Barendrecht

Shell CO2 Storage B.V. (SCS) is in the process of starting up a demonstration for subsurface sequestration of pure CO2 coming from the Shell refinery in Pernis, the Netherlands.

The CO2 will be transported by pipeline to the depleted gas fields of Barendrecht en Barendrecht-Ziedewij, where it will be sequestered. A large study on all possible risks was carried out together with TNO and a dedicated monitoring plan was set up. SCS builds on the wide operational knowledge within Shell which includes decades of experience with safe Underground Gas Storage. They aim for the storage 10 million tons of CO2 over a period

of 25 years.
